About FabricLoop
FabricLoop is one workspace for everything a team does: messaging, tasks, notes, news and events, video and audio calls, people, and AI agents — all organised through Groups. Most teams run on four or five tools that don't talk to each other. Tasks live in one app, notes in another, and decisions disappear into a chat nobody re-reads. Someone ends up acting as the integration layer, retyping the same information from one place into the next. FabricLoop removes that work. Tap a message and it becomes a task, with the due date and a link back to where it came from. Highlight a line in a note and it becomes a task. Finish a call and the live transcript drafts the tasks, notes and updates for you to approve. Context travels with the work instead of being rebuilt by hand. Because messaging and calls live in the same app as the tasks and notes, there is no separate chat tool or meeting tool to pay for and switch between. Loop Agent, our built-in AI, works across every group and surface: ask it about any task, note or thread, turn messages into tasks, draft updates, and get calls summarised automatically. Connect your own tools over MCP. Free for small teams — unlimited users, up to 10 groups, 90 days of message history. Standard is $10 per user/month, or $96 per user/year. Enterprise adds SSO, audit logs, custom retention and an admin console. Available on iOS, iPad, Mac, Windows, Android and the web, in 40 languages. Start free at fabricloop.com
